Comments on the production information

  • MINING MAGAZINE, 9/75, P. 211, REPORTS AN EXPANSION PROGRAM AT BOTH LARYMNA'S HAGIOS JOANNIA AND EUBOEA MINES, LEADING TO THE COMBINED PRODUCTION OF 5-MILLION MTPY ORE, IN 1980.

General comments

Subject category Comment text
Deposit LOCATED ON THE ISLAND OF EUBOEA, 18 MILES FROM THE PLANT AT LARYMNA. DEPOSITS OCCUR IN UPPER CRETACEOUS LIMESTONE, WHICH COVER AN AREA OF 67,000 STREMATA (1000 SQ. METERS). AS OF 7/73, ONLY 5000 STREMATA HAD BEEN INVESTIGATED; BASED ON DATA FROM THESE 5000 STREMATA, IT IS QUITE POSSIBLE THAT THE ENTIRE DEPOSITS CONTAIN 600-MILLION METRIC TONS OF ORE, AS 200-MILL. METRIC TONS CERTAIN/ALMOST CERTAIN RESERVES, AND 400-MILL. METRIC TONS PROBABLE/POTENTIAL RESERVES. THE DEPOSITS AT EUBOEA, WHILE CONSIDERED TO BE LOW-GRADE (1.1-1.3% NI), ARE COMPLETELY FREE OF ARSENIC AND ARE BEING MINED TO AN INCREASING EXTENT. LARCO (OWNER) IS ATTEMPTING TO EXPAND PRODUCTION TO 35,000 M.T.P.Y. BETWEEN ITS EUBOEA AND HAGIOS JOANNIS MINES, (SEE MINING MAGAZINE, 7/73, FOR COMPLETE DESCRIPTION OF MINES.
